Topics Covered
- 1. Introduction to Error Detection: Learners will study fundamental concepts of software errors, their causes, and basic methodologies for error detection. They will gain skills in identifying common error types and using simple tools for preliminary analysis.
- 2. Static Analysis Techniques: Learners will delve into static analysis tools and techniques, learning how to use them to detect potential issues in code without executing the software. Practical skills include setting up and interpreting static analysis reports.
- 3. Dynamic Analysis Fundamentals: This module covers dynamic analysis methods, focusing on runtime behavior. Learners will learn how to use dynamic analysis tools to identify errors during software execution, enhancing their ability to understand and fix runtime issues.
- 4. Automated Testing Methods: Learners will explore various automated testing techniques, including unit, integration, and system testing. They will gain hands-on experience in designing and implementing automated test cases to detect and prevent software errors.
- 5. Debugging Strategies: This module focuses on advanced debugging techniques and strategies. Learners will learn how to use debugging tools effectively to locate and resolve complex software issues, improving their problem-solving skills.
- 6. Code Review Processes: Learners will study the principles and practices of code reviews, including peer review and automated code review tools. They will develop skills in providing and receiving constructive feedback to improve code quality and error detection.
- 7. Performance Testing and Profiling: This module covers performance testing techniques and tools. Learners will learn how to identify and resolve performance bottlenecks, ensuring that software systems meet performance requirements and are free of errors that affect performance.
- 8. Security Testing and Vulnerability Analysis: Learners will study security testing methodologies and tools, focusing on detecting vulnerabilities and ensuring software security. They will gain skills in conducting security audits and integrating security into the error detection process.
- 9. Complex System Integration Testing: This module addresses the challenges of testing integrated systems, covering strategies and tools for testing complex system interactions. Learners will learn how to ensure that components work together seamlessly and detect integration-related errors.
- 10. Error Management and Reporting: Learners will study best practices for managing and reporting errors in complex software systems. They will learn how to create effective error reports, prioritize issues, and work collaboratively to resolve errors in a timely manner.
